What matters most for small dogs
When choosing a natural pet hair vacuum for small dogs, prioritize lightweight and compact designs that are easy to maneuver around tight spaces where small dogs often lounge. Look for vacuums with gentle suction power to avoid startling or stressing your pet, as small dogs can be more sensitive to noise and strong airflow. Opt for models with washable filters to handle fine hair and dander efficiently, since small breeds tend to shed less but more frequently. Avoid bulky or overly powerful vacuums, as they can be cumbersome and intimidating for small dogs, making grooming sessions stressful.
Focus on vacuums with specialized attachments like mini brushes or crevice tools to reach small areas where pet hair accumulates, such as between couch cushions or under furniture. Avoid vacuums with harsh chemicals or strong odors, as small dogs have more sensitive respiratory systems. A quiet operation is crucial to prevent anxiety, especially for breeds prone to nervousness. Lastly, ensure the vacuum has a reliable cord or battery life to avoid frequent interruptions during cleaning, which can unsettle your pet.
